Heim  >  Artikel  >  tägliche Programmierung  >  Was bedeutet automatische Transaktion in der MySQL-Datentabelle?

Was bedeutet automatische Transaktion in der MySQL-Datentabelle?

藏色散人
藏色散人Original
2018-10-30 16:50:184585Durchsuche

In diesem Artikel erfahren Sie hauptsächlich, was automatische Transaktionen in der MySQL-Datentabelle bedeuten.

Automatische Transaktionen sind, wie der Name schon sagt, Transaktionen, die keine manuelle Arbeit erfordern. Das Gegenstück zu automatischen Transaktionen sind manuelle Transaktionen, die wir Ihnen in früheren Artikeln ausführlich vorgestellt haben . Sie müssen zuerst auf diese Artikel verweisen.

[Was bedeutet Transaktion in der MySQL-Datentabelle]

[So öffnen Sie eine Transaktion in der MySQL-Datentabelle]

[So legen Sie den Rollback-Punkt für manuelle Transaktionen in MySQL-Datentabellen fest]

Der Schwerpunkt dieses Abschnitts liegt darauf, Ihnen die Definition automatischer Transaktionen in MySQL-Datentabellen zu erklären.

Zuerst manuelle Transaktionen, einfach ausgedrückt: Speichern Sie die von uns ausgeführten SQL-Anweisungen im Transaktionsprotokoll und öffnen Sie dann manuell Transaktionen, schreiben Sie Transaktionen fest, setzen Sie Transaktionen zurück usw., um unsere Transaktionsprotokolle zu verarbeiten zur Bearbeitung.

Dann bedeutet automatische Transaktion, dass wir unsere SQL-Anweisung direkt an die Datenbank senden können, ohne eine Transaktion öffnen, eine Transaktion festschreiben, ein Rollback usw. durchführen zu müssen.

Bei unseren täglichen Operationen an der Datentabelle können wir feststellen, dass eine einzelne SELECT-Anweisung die Datentabelle abfragen, löschen und einfügen kann und wir sie überhaupt nicht manuell übermitteln müssen.

Das liegt daran, dass es sich bei unserer Reihe von Datentabellenoperationen um automatische Transaktionen handelt.

Unter normalen Umständen befinden sich die Grundoperationen der Datentabelle grundsätzlich in der standardmäßigen automatischen Transaktion.

Nachfolgend können wir kurz zusammenfassen, die Definition automatischer MySQL-Transaktionen.

Standardmäßig ist die MySQL-Datentabelle im Auto-Commit-Modus aktiviert (die Variable Auto-Commit ist aktiviert).

Das heißt, solange Sie die Anweisung des DML-Vorgangs (Einfügen, Aktualisieren, Löschen) ausführen, wird MySQL die Transaktion sofort implizit festschreiben (implizites Festschreiben).

Transaktionen automatisch festschreiben: Jedes Mal, wenn eine SQL-Anweisung ausgeführt wird, wird sie mit der Datenbank synchronisiert .

Dieser Artikel ist eine Einführung in die grundlegende Definition automatischer Transaktionen in MySQL-Datentabellen. Ich hoffe, dass er durch diese Einführung hilfreich sein kann Hilfe für einige unerfahrene Freunde!

In späteren Artikeln werden wir Ihnen weiterhin spezifische Wissenspunkte zu automatischen Transaktionen in MySQL-Datentabellen vermitteln.

Wenn Sie mehr über MySQL erfahren möchten, können Sie der chinesischen PHP-Website MySQL-Video-Tutorial folgen. Jeder ist herzlich willkommen, sich darauf zu beziehen und zu lernen!

Das obige ist der detaillierte Inhalt vonWas bedeutet automatische Transaktion in der MySQL-Datentabelle?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n